Roof Cleaning in Vancouver, WA
Roof cleaning services involve the removal of dirt, moss, algae, and other debris that accumulate on a roof’s surface over time. This process helps maintain the roof’s appearance and can extend its lifespan by preventing damage caused by organic growth and buildup. Projects typically include cleaning asphalt shingles, tile, metal, or other roofing materials, and may involve gentle washing techniques to avoid damage. Roof Cleaning Questions
What types of roofs can be cleaned? Roof cleaning services typically address asphalt shingles, metal, tile, and wood shake roofs to remove dirt, moss, and algae.
Is roof cleaning safe for my shingles? Yes, professional roof cleaning uses gentle, effective methods that help preserve roof materials and prevent damage.
What causes roofs to need cleaning? Accumulation of moss, algae, lichen, and dirt over time can lead to staining, moisture retention, and potential damage.
How often should a roof be cleaned? Most roofs benefit from cleaning every few years to maintain appearance and prevent buildup that can affect longevity.
